The labor contract after being signed and sealed can still be changed by the will of one party or both parties. In fact, in the process of its non-stop movement, there are times when enterprises need to mobilize and transfer employees to ensure the progress of a certain job or contract. This transfer can take one of two forms: temporary transfer and permanent transfer.

Temporary job transfer

Article 31 of Labor Code 2012 specifies the transfer of employees to jobs other than labor contracts as follows:

Decree 05/2015/ND-CP dated 12 January 2015 of the Government detailing and guiding the implementation of several contents of the Labor Code (“Decree 05/2015/ND-CP“) also prescribe this case as follows:

Article 8. Temporary job transfer

Temporary transfer of employees to perform jobs which are not stated in employment contracts in Clause 1, Article 31 of Labor Code shall be prescribed as follows :

1. The employer shall be entitled to temporarily transfer the employee to perform jobs other than those in the labor contract in the following cases:

a) Natural disasters, conflagration, epidemics;

b) Application of preventive and remedial measures against occupational accidents and diseases;

c) Electricity and water supply failure;

d) Operating demands.      

2. The employer shall specify in the corporate rules that the employer may temporarily transfer the employee to jobs other than those in the labor contract due to production and business demands.

3. If employers have temporarily transferred their employees to perform jobs other than those in the employment contract for 60 cumulative working days in a year, and they continue to temporarily transfer the employees to perform jobs other than those defined in the employment contract, the written consent shall be obtained from the employees.

4. If the employees do not agree to be temporarily transferred to the jobs other than those in the employment contracts as specified in Clause 3 of this Article and quit their jobs, the employers shall pay them salary for such quit as prescribed in Clause 1 of Article 98 of the Labor Code.

For this matter, the Labor Code 2019 has synthesized the contents of the provisions of Labor Code 2012 and Decree 05/2015/ND-CP, thus in general the provisions on the job transfer of Labor Code 2019 are more detailed and do not conflict with Labor Code 2012.

Permanent job transfer

Based on Point c, Clause 1, Article 23 of the Labor Code 2012 (corresponding to Point c, Clause 1, Article 21 of Labor Code 2019), the job and the workplace are one of the must-have contents of the labor contract. Therefore, when wanting to change job (change of job, workplace), the employer must amend and supplement the labor contract in accordance with Article 35 of Labor Code 2012 (similar provisions in Article 33 of Labor Code 2019).

The employer must notify the employee at least 3 working days in advance of the job transfer. If the two parties can reach an agreement, the amendment and supplement shall be carried out by signing the labor contract appendix or concluding a new labor contract. If the two parties do not come to an agreement, they will continue to perform the signed labor contract.
